Arons en Gelauff Architecten

The winning proposal by Amsterdam architects Floor Arons and Arnoud Gelauff deals with the reconstruction of the waste silos in the Zeeburg suburb. By 2011, a new cultural center is set to be established in the renovated technical building, which will be named after the significant Dutch children's book author Annie MG Schmidt (1911-95).
The multifunctional building will also include apartments, a rooftop playground, and the restaurant Praq op 't daq. Exhibition spaces, a multimedia center, a cinema, a theater, shops, and restaurants will be open to visitors seven days a week. This unique revitalization of the dilapidated silos will help breathe new life into the entire residential area of Zeeburgereiland. Landscape architects Rob Aben and Janneke Hooymans also contributed to the final appearance of the project.
